Definition ∞ Modular DeFi Architecture describes a design approach where decentralized finance protocols are constructed from independent, interoperable components. This allows developers to combine various building blocks, such as lending pools, automated market makers, and oracle services, to create novel financial applications. The modularity promotes flexibility, innovation, and easier auditing of individual components. It reduces systemic risk by isolating potential issues within specific modules.
Context ∞ The discussion around modular DeFi architecture emphasizes its benefits for rapid innovation and enhanced security within the decentralized finance space. A key debate concerns establishing universal standards for component interoperability and ensuring seamless communication between different modules. Future developments are focused on creating more standardized and composable DeFi primitives, which will allow for the assembly of increasingly complex and resilient financial products and services.
